Inventory Management System Project Report Doc in C

Overview of Inventory Management Systems

Inventory management systems are crucial tools that help businesses track and manage their stock levels, orders, sales, and deliveries. In today’s fast-paced commercial environment, where efficiency and accuracy are paramount, these systems have become indispensable for organizations of all sizes. They streamline operations, minimize costs, and enhance overall productivity.

Who Uses Inventory Management Systems?

A wide range of industries and businesses benefit from inventory management systems, including:

  • Retailers: From small shops to large e-commerce platforms, retailers use these systems to manage their stock, ensuring they have the right products available at the right time.
  • Manufacturers: They rely on inventory systems to track raw materials and finished goods, helping to maintain production schedules and avoid shortages.
  • Wholesalers: These businesses use inventory management to handle large volumes of products and ensure timely distribution to retailers.
  • Restaurants: Food service establishments utilize these systems to manage food inventory, reducing waste and ensuring freshness.
  • Healthcare Providers: Hospitals and clinics manage medical supplies and pharmaceuticals, ensuring that critical items are always in stock.

Problems Solved by Inventory Management Systems

The implementation of an inventory management system addresses several key challenges that businesses face:

  1. Stockouts and Overstocks: One of the primary issues in inventory management is maintaining the right balance of stock. An effective system helps prevent stockouts, which can lead to lost sales, and overstocks, which tie up capital and increase storage costs.
  2. Inaccurate Inventory Tracking: Manual tracking methods are prone to errors. Inventory management systems automate tracking, ensuring that data is accurate and up-to-date.
  3. Time Consumption: Managing inventory manually can be a time-consuming process. Automated systems streamline operations, allowing staff to focus on more strategic tasks.
  4. Data Analysis: Modern inventory systems provide valuable insights through data analytics, helping businesses make informed decisions about purchasing, sales trends, and inventory turnover.
  5. Supply Chain Coordination: These systems enhance communication and coordination with suppliers and distributors, ensuring a smoother supply chain process.

In a world where customer expectations are constantly rising, having a robust inventory management system can be the difference between success and failure. By addressing these challenges, businesses can operate more efficiently, reduce costs, and ultimately improve customer satisfaction.

Core Features and Functionalities of Inventory Management Systems

Inventory management systems come equipped with a variety of features and functionalities designed to meet the diverse needs of businesses. These systems leverage technology to enhance operational efficiency, reduce errors, and provide valuable insights into inventory management.

Core Features

The following table outlines the core features of inventory management systems, along with their descriptions:

Feature Description
Real-Time Tracking Enables businesses to monitor stock levels in real-time, helping to prevent stockouts and overstocks.
Automated Reordering Automatically generates purchase orders when stock levels fall below predefined thresholds, ensuring timely replenishment.
Inventory Auditing Facilitates regular audits and stock counts to ensure accuracy and compliance with accounting standards.
Reporting and Analytics Provides detailed reports on inventory turnover, sales trends, and stock performance, aiding in strategic decision-making.
Multi-Location Management Supports businesses with multiple warehouses or retail locations, allowing centralized tracking and management of inventory across all sites.
User-Friendly Interface Features an intuitive interface that simplifies navigation and reduces the learning curve for users.
Integration Capabilities Seamlessly integrates with other business systems such as accounting software, e-commerce platforms, and supply chain management tools.

Functionalities

Beyond core features, inventory management systems offer a range of functionalities that enhance their effectiveness:

  • Barcode Scanning: Utilizes barcode technology to streamline the process of receiving, tracking, and shipping inventory, reducing manual entry errors.
  • Mobile Access: Many systems offer mobile applications, allowing users to manage inventory on-the-go, which is particularly useful for retail and warehouse staff.
  • Supplier Management: Facilitates the management of supplier information, performance tracking, and communication, ensuring a smooth procurement process.
  • Customer Management: Helps businesses track customer purchases and preferences, enabling better service and targeted marketing efforts.

Advantages of Inventory Management Systems

Implementing an inventory management system provides several advantages that can significantly impact a business’s bottom line:

  1. Cost Savings: By optimizing stock levels and reducing waste, businesses can save money on excess inventory and storage costs.
  2. Improved Efficiency: Automation of routine tasks allows employees to focus on higher-value activities, increasing overall productivity.
  3. Enhanced Accuracy: With real-time data and automated processes, the likelihood of errors decreases, leading to more reliable inventory records.
  4. Better Customer Satisfaction: By ensuring that the right products are available when customers need them, businesses can enhance customer loyalty and satisfaction.
  5. Data-Driven Decisions: Access to comprehensive analytics enables businesses to make informed decisions regarding purchasing, sales strategies, and inventory management.

Relevant Technologies and Tools

Several technologies and tools play a crucial role in the functionality of inventory management systems:

  • Cloud Computing: Many modern inventory systems are cloud-based, allowing for remote access and real-time updates from anywhere.
  • Artificial Intelligence: AI algorithms can analyze inventory data to forecast demand and optimize stock levels, improving overall efficiency.
  • Internet of Things (IoT): IoT devices can provide real-time data on inventory conditions, such as temperature and humidity, which is especially important for perishable goods.

Overall, an effective inventory management system is a vital component for any business looking to enhance operational efficiency, reduce costs, and improve customer satisfaction.

Real-World Applications of Inventory Management Systems

Inventory management systems are not just theoretical concepts; they are actively used by various businesses and organizations to streamline operations, enhance accuracy, and improve cost-effectiveness. Below are examples of how different sectors leverage these systems to achieve their goals.

Examples of Usage in Businesses

The following table highlights specific businesses and organizations, detailing how they utilize inventory management systems and the benefits they reap:

Business/Organization Application Benefits
Walmart Walmart employs a sophisticated inventory management system that tracks stock levels across thousands of stores in real-time. Improved stock accuracy and reduced stockouts, leading to enhanced customer satisfaction and increased sales.
Amazon Amazon uses automated inventory management to manage millions of products, optimizing warehouse space and fulfillment processes. Increased efficiency in order processing and reduced operational costs through automation and data analytics.
Starbucks Starbucks tracks inventory for its coffee beans and other ingredients using a centralized system to manage supply across its global locations. Minimized waste and ensured product freshness, leading to cost savings and improved quality control.
Home Depot Home Depot utilizes an inventory management system to monitor stock levels in stores and warehouses, coordinating with suppliers for timely replenishment. Enhanced accuracy in inventory levels, reducing excess stock and improving cash flow.
Target Target employs a multi-location inventory management system that helps track products across various stores and distribution centers. Improved visibility of inventory across locations, leading to better stock availability and reduced lead times.

How Inventory Management Systems Improve Efficiency, Accuracy, and Cost-Effectiveness

The benefits of using inventory management systems extend beyond mere tracking of stock. Here’s how these systems contribute to efficiency, accuracy, and cost-effectiveness:

  • Efficiency: Automation of inventory processes reduces the time spent on manual tasks such as counting stock and placing orders. For instance, Amazon’s automated system allows for rapid fulfillment, enabling them to ship products quickly and efficiently.
  • Accuracy: Real-time tracking minimizes human errors associated with manual inventory counts. Walmart’s system ensures that stock levels are always accurate, which is crucial for maintaining customer trust and satisfaction.
  • Cost-Effectiveness: By preventing overstocking and stockouts, businesses can save significantly on storage costs and lost sales. Starbucks, for example, reduces waste by ensuring that ingredients are used before they expire, leading to lower operational costs.

Sector-Specific Benefits

Different sectors experience unique advantages from implementing inventory management systems:

  1. Retail: Retailers like Target benefit from improved customer service as they can quickly locate products and maintain optimal stock levels, ensuring customers find what they need.
  2. Food and Beverage: Companies like Starbucks can maintain high-quality standards by managing the freshness of perishable goods, which is critical in the food industry.
  3. Manufacturing: Manufacturers use inventory systems to streamline production schedules, ensuring that raw materials are available when needed, thus avoiding costly downtime.

In summary, the practical applications of inventory management systems in real-world businesses demonstrate their critical role in enhancing operational efficiency, accuracy, and cost-effectiveness across various sectors. By leveraging these systems, organizations can make informed decisions that drive growth and improve customer satisfaction.

Challenges and Considerations in Implementing Inventory Management Systems

While inventory management systems offer numerous benefits, they also come with their own set of challenges and limitations. Understanding these issues is critical for businesses looking to implement or optimize their inventory management practices.

Common Challenges

The following are some of the most common challenges businesses face when using or implementing inventory management systems:

  • High Initial Costs: Implementing a comprehensive inventory management system can require significant upfront investment in software, hardware, and training.
  • Complexity of Integration: Integrating the inventory management system with existing software (like accounting or ERP systems) can be complex and time-consuming, often requiring specialized expertise.
  • Data Accuracy: Inaccurate data entry can lead to discrepancies in inventory levels, resulting in stockouts or excess inventory. Businesses must ensure that all users are trained to input data correctly.
  • User Resistance: Employees may resist adopting new technology, especially if they are accustomed to manual processes. Change management strategies are essential to facilitate a smooth transition.
  • Scalability Issues: Some systems may not scale well as a business grows, leading to performance issues or the need for a costly upgrade.

Limitations of Inventory Management Systems

Despite their advantages, inventory management systems may have limitations that organizations should consider:

  1. Dependence on Technology: A reliance on technology means that system failures or outages can disrupt operations, making it vital to have backup plans in place.
  2. Customization Constraints: Some off-the-shelf systems may not offer the level of customization required to meet specific business needs, potentially leading to inefficiencies.
  3. Training Requirements: Employees may require extensive training to effectively use the system, which can take time and resources away from other tasks.
  4. Data Security Risks: Storing sensitive inventory data in a digital format can expose businesses to cybersecurity threats, necessitating robust security measures.

Things to Consider When Implementing an Inventory Management System

When planning to implement an inventory management system, businesses should consider the following factors:

  • Business Needs: Assess the specific needs of the organization to choose a system that aligns with operational goals and processes.
  • Scalability: Ensure that the chosen system can scale with the business as it grows, accommodating increased inventory levels and additional locations.
  • Vendor Support: Evaluate the level of customer support and training provided by the software vendor, as ongoing support can be crucial for long-term success.
  • User-Friendliness: Select a system with an intuitive interface to reduce the learning curve and increase user adoption.
  • Integration Capabilities: Look for systems that can easily integrate with existing tools and software to streamline operations.

Best Practices for Effective Implementation

To maximize the benefits of an inventory management system, businesses should follow these best practices:

  1. Conduct a Needs Assessment: Before implementation, conduct a thorough analysis of current inventory processes to identify areas for improvement.
  2. Involve Stakeholders: Engage employees from various departments in the selection and implementation process to ensure that the system meets diverse needs.
  3. Provide Comprehensive Training: Offer training sessions to ensure that all users are comfortable with the system, which can help reduce resistance and improve data accuracy.
  4. Regularly Review and Update: Continuously monitor the system’s performance and make adjustments as necessary to optimize its effectiveness.
  5. Emphasize Data Security: Implement robust security measures to protect sensitive inventory data from potential cyber threats.

Future Outlook

As technology continues to evolve, the future of inventory management systems looks promising. Innovations such as artificial intelligence, machine learning, and the Internet of Things (IoT) are expected to enhance the capabilities of these systems, enabling even greater efficiency and accuracy. Businesses that stay ahead of these trends will likely find themselves better positioned to meet the demands of an increasingly competitive marketplace. By addressing current challenges and adopting best practices, organizations can successfully navigate the complexities of inventory management and unlock its full potential.

Leave a Reply

Your email address will not be published. Required fields are marked *